Exposing Myths and Truths / New Developments/Ancient Evidence / The Intellects / Uncategorized

True Origin of Medusa – The lady with the snake hair? Or Dreadlocks?

Medusa, a real woman, was the Afrikan serpent-goddess said to have worn a pouch around her waist containing live snakes that represented wisdom and renewal. She was said to have carried the original Gorgon mask to frighten off the unskilled, and it was painted red to symbolize the power of […]